How Melbourne compares within Kentucky

Melbourne ranks 58th of 171 cities in Kentucky by permit count; Louisville leads the state with 255 holders.

The 3 permit holders listed here represent 0.3% of Kentucky's 946 statewide Basic Permits in the August 2026 TTB extract — a city-level slice of the federal registry, not a local liquor-license roll.

Nationwide, Melbourne sits at #4,072 of 11,126 U.S. cities with at least one permit premises in the TTB file — placement by count only, not production volume or retail outlets.

The U.S. Census Bureau's ACS 2024 five-year estimate puts Melbourne's population at 627. That works out to 478.5 federal Basic Permit premises per 100,000 residents in this registry — a premises-density comparison, not a measure of alcohol production or consumption.

Wineries dominate this city's mix (3 of 3, 100%) — including 4 Mile Wine CO., Forgotten Gods Meadery, LLC, Stonebrook Winery.
